## Vendor Note: GiftLedger Receipt Mailer

Outbound donation receipts for the Harrowfield Foundation platform are sent through GiftLedger, a third-party mailer under a managed-service contract. If the receipt queue backs up past 30 minutes, do not restart our ingest worker first — GiftLedger throttles reconnect storms and will blacklist the sender pool. Instead, check their status page snapshot in the runbook, then open a priority case with their operations desk at the address below.

escalation mailbox, hadug-bajog: sormir@norvalabs.internal

Ticket: Missed Pick-up — Replacement Server, Larkwood Branch

The replacement server for the Larkwood branch office was staged in the front vestibule by 08:00, but the Vellum Freight driver never arrived. The unit is now locked in the storage room to keep it secure overnight. A new pick-up is confirmed for tomorrow morning. Please note the confidential hand-over instruction below.

courier memo of fafof-badug: the aldvan holix courier leaves the ruswyn tamys briael zormir lamius sorox briwyn aldmir ledger at gate 1537 under passcode 562199

- [ ] Step 7: Archive cold storage buckets (Glacierline tier). Confirm both ceremony witnesses are present, verify bucket manifests match the Oxbow ledger, then seal the archive key shares. Plugin authors may observe but not handle shares. Once sealed, the archive index itself is encrypted and can only be reopened with the passphrase below.

vault phrase of badup-hahig = tamael-aldael-kelmir-istael-fenok-istwyn-tamius-jorath-oliion

## Sweeper: orphaned-resource cleanup (Tarnwick cluster)

The Brambleclear sweeper enumerates unattached volumes and expired snapshots every six hours, deleting only resources tagged by its own provisioner. All deletions are logged with a two-step confirmation and a 48-hour soft-delete window. For your review, its complete active configuration is reproduced below.

deployment values, yadug-bawif:
[framir]
team = pelox
access_code = ac_a38ab2
owner = tamion.julael
host = framir.tolvaqlabs.test
port = 11211
peer = tammir.zemvargrid.local
salt = 2215ef03
pin = 1541